Frequently Asked Questions

The questions that come up on just about every estimate we write.

Can you repair my roof instead of replacing it in Highland?

Often, yes. Plenty of the Highland roofs we get called to look at need flashing reworked or a section refastened, not a whole new roof. We will tell you honestly which one you are looking at, and if it is repairable we would rather repair it.

What does a new shingle roof cost in Highland?

A typical Highland shingle roof runs roughly $8,000 to $18,000 in 2026 for an average single family home, and more if the deck has rot or the roof is steep and cut up with dormers. We do not price off a satellite photo — somebody comes out and measures.

Is a metal roof worth it for a Highland home?

For most Highland homes, yes. A metal roof costs more up front than shingles, but it usually outlives two or three shingle roofs, sheds rain and snow better, and does not peel off in a hard wind. We will price metal and shingle side by side so you can compare real numbers instead of guessing.

How long does it take to put a new roof on in Highland?

Most Highland houses are a two to four day job. A straightforward shingle roof can be done in a day or two. A cut up metal roof takes longer because every panel, valley and trim piece is measured and fit on site rather than pulled out of a box.

Is a metal roof loud in the rain in Highland?

Much less than people expect. Over solid decking with underlayment under it, a Highland metal roof sounds about like a shingle roof from inside the house. The loud tin roof people remember was screwed straight to open purlins over a barn with nothing underneath.

Do you do gutters and soffit work in Highland too?

Yes. Gutters, guards, soffit and fascia are all part of keeping the edge of a Highland roof dry, so we handle them along with the roof instead of sending you off to find somebody else to finish the job.
